Output ecfd51b3e9f233048e54729962fbc0ecea817b81d23e43b37e6680f020d3777a:0

value
2856000
script pubkey
OP_0 OP_PUSHBYTES_20 31e724ba3fb1619af0db1c419717c28bcee7801c
address
bc1qx8njfw3lk9se4uxmr3qew97z308w0qqutq993d
transaction
ecfd51b3e9f233048e54729962fbc0ecea817b81d23e43b37e6680f020d3777a
spent
true